‚Urban Plant Secrets‘ explores the fascinating world of plant adaptation in city environments, revealing how flora develops remarkable survival strategies in response to unique urban challenges. This comprehensive work bridges the gap between botanical science and urban ecology, examining how plants modify their behavior and biology to thrive amid artificial lighting, pollution, and temperature variations in metropolitan areas.

The book progresses through three distinct sections, beginning with fundamental plant biology and adaptation mechanisms, then exploring specific urban microhabitats like sidewalk cracks and vertical gardens, and concluding with practical applications for urban planning and biodiversity conservation. Through detailed case studies and research gathered from major global cities, readers discover how plants alter their gene expression, develop modified root systems, and enhance their pollution tolerance to survive in built environments.

What sets this work apart is its blend of cutting-edge genomic analysis with traditional botanical surveys, creating a thorough understanding of urban plant communities. The author presents complex biological concepts in an accessible manner, making it valuable for both academics and educated general readers interested in urban ecology. By connecting plant adaptation to broader issues like air quality, temperature regulation, and human well-being, the book offers crucial insights for urban planners, landscape architects, and anyone interested in supporting sustainable urban ecosystems.
